Comprehending the Exotic Animal Trade
The unique animal trade describes the purchasing and selling of animals that are not typically domesticated. This consists of reptiles, birds, fish, and mammals. The market for such animals has grown considerably in the last few years, driven by aspects such as social media influence and a growing fascination with distinct pets.

Before considering an exotic animal as an animal, it is vital to understand the legal landscape. Numerous exotic animals are protected under national and global laws. The Convention on International Trade in Endangered Species of Wild Fauna and Flora (CITES) manages and keeps track of the worldwide trade of species that are threatened or endangered.
Common Legal Points to ConsiderLocal and State Laws: Regulations can vary widely by place. The ethics of owning an exotic pet can not be neglected. Captive breeding versus wild capture is a considerable dispute within the community.
Ethical Questions to PonderSource of the Animal: Is the animal reproduced in captivity or caught from the wild?Well-being of the Species: Does the family pet trade contribute to the decrease of wild populations?Long-term Commitment: Many exotic animals need specialized care, which might not work with every way of life.Preparing for Ownership
Owning an exotic animal includes more than just the preliminary purchase. Possible owners must prepare for the long-term commitment connected with these special animals.

A: Common unique pets include reptiles (like iguanas and snakes), birds (such as parrots), small mammals (like ferrets and sugar gliders), and fish (such as arowanas and piranhas).
Q: How can I ensure the animal's welfare?
A: Research the particular needs of the species you are thinking about. This consists of habitat, diet, and social requirements. Guarantee you have access to veterinary care specialized in unique types.
Q: Are exotic animals ideal for first-time family pet owners?
A: Exotic animals typically have specific needs and might not be ideal for newbie pet owners. It is essential to educate oneself about the responsibilities involved before making a purchase.
